drm/msm/dpu: stop using raw IRQ indices in the kernel traces
Browse files Browse the repository at this point in the history
In preparation to reworking IRQ indcies, stop using raw indices in
kernel traces. Instead use a pair of register index and bit. This
corresponds closer to the values in HW catalog.
